![]() |
|
||||||||||
|
|||||
|
Регистрация: Jan 2006
Сообщений: 12
|
Люди добрые, нужна ваша помощь! Подскажите как сделать так, чтобы определенная область флеша случайным образом заполнялась квадратиками, но с проверкой перекрытия(тобишь надо чтоб в одном месте мог находиться только один квадратик, не больше(см.рис). Дублирование реализовать мне удалось, но вот с проверкой проблемы. Я использовал сл. скрипт:
s++; if(i !== p[i] && j !== p[i][j]){ box._x = 4*i; box._y = 4*j; _root.box.duplicateMovieClip(box[i+j],s); i=Math.round(464*Math.random()/4); j=Math.round(56*Math.random()/4); }else{ do{ i=Math.round(464*Math.random()/4); j=Math.round(56*Math.random()/4);}while(i == p[i] && j == p[i][j]); } Ошибку найти не могу. Явно не хватает опыта и знаний. Буду очень благодарен за помощь! Заранее спасибо! |
![]() |
Часовой пояс GMT +4, время: 09:41. |
|
|
« Предыдущая тема | Следующая тема » |
|
|